Nets Draft 2017 – Draft Guide - 10 Bigs to Bet On

This year’s NBA Draft is littered with big men of all shape, size and skill. Post-lottery, that becomes evident as a majority of picks 15-30 projected as big men. Prospects that project as stretch 4s, defensive stoppers and lobs-and-blocks bigs live in the post-lottery first round in many mock drafts.

It’s may be likely that Brooklyn selects a big man at pick 22, 27, or both. Sixteen recent NBA mock drafts have Sean Marks and his staff selecting a big with at least one of their first round selections. While the Nets may need a dose of talent at every position, going big in this year’s Draft could be the best option, with the free agent big man market depleted (and likely overpriced), and the Nets featuring only two players taller than 6’10” in 2016-2017.
